QUEENS ADULT CARE CENTER ALP – NPI #1669885174
Assisted Living Facility

A facility providing supportive services to individuals who can function independently in most areas of activity, but need assistance and/or monitoring to assure safety and well being.

QUEENS ADULT CARE CENTER ALP is an assisted living facility located in ELMHURST, NY. NPPES has assigned the NPI number 1669885174 to QUEENS ADULT CARE CENTER ALP on June 03, 2014. It is a Type-2 NPI, indicating this NPI number is associated with an organization. Since the name “QUEENS ADULT CARE CENTER ALP” is a dba name, the actual legal business name for this organization is HOFGUR LLC. The primary taxonomy selected by this provider is 310400000X from the Health Care Provider Taxonomy code set, which is classified as Assisted Living Facility.
